The beauty treatments you can and still CANNOT get as nail bars and beauty salons reopen

Beauty salons are to reopen in England next week – but face waxing, eyelash treatments, make-up application and facials are not allowed. Nail bars, tattoo and massage studios, body and skin piercing services, physical therapy businesses and spas will also be able to reopen from Monday under new Government plans.
